Vertonghen ‘not afraid’ of Argentina

Belgium defender Jan Vertonghen believes that his side are good enough to beat Argentina and qualify for the World Cup semi-finals.

The Red Devils take on the Albicelestes in Brasilia this afternoon, and the Tottenham centre-back has claimed that his men can knock Lionel Messi and co out of the tournament.

“We have been confident all tournament. We believe in ourselves. We are feeling strong physically and mentally. Belgium don't have to fear anyone,” he told reporters.

“We have all been looking forward to this tournament. It's all about games like this for us. But it doesn't have to stop here against Argentina.

“We want to put in a great fight and go even further. This is all a reward for our hard work.

“Messi has been outstanding so far. He's obviously Argentina's main man. There are more players to watch, but he has been outstanding.

“I spoke with Dries Mertens about Gonzalo Higuain. He is a big fan of him and has warned us that he's a great player. 

“And they have Ezequiel Lavezzi and Angel Di Maria as well. We will have to be on top of our game.”
